HCRM博客

为何Origin环境中阶乘计算出现错误?

Origin 阶乘报错?别慌,咱一起搞定它!

新手小白们,你们在用 Origin 做数据分析、绘图的时候,有没有遇到过阶乘报错的情况呀?😟就像你满心欢喜地准备大干一场,结果突然给你来个“小插曲”,是不是挺闹心的?不过别愁,今天咱就来好好唠唠这 Origin 阶乘报错的那些事儿,让你轻松应对,不再害怕!😎

为何Origin环境中阶乘计算出现错误?-图1
(图片来源网络,侵权删除)

一、啥是 Origin 阶乘报错?🤔

就是你在使用 Origin 软件进行一些涉及阶乘运算的操作时,软件给你弹出个报错提示,告诉你运算进行不下去啦,就好比你想做饭,结果发现炉灶打不着火,这饭就没法正常做了呀,比如说,你在处理一些统计数据,需要计算某个数值的阶乘来进一步分析数据趋势,这时候如果出现了阶乘报错,那后续的分析可就受影响了。📉

二、为啥会出现阶乘报错呢?🤷‍♂️

(一)数据格式不对🤯

有时候咱从别的地方复制粘贴过来的数据,可能格式上不太符合 Origin 的“胃口”,就好比你给一个只能吃馒头的机器喂了面包,它肯定不乐意呀,比如说,数据里包含了一些非数字的字符,像字母、符号啥的,这在做阶乘运算的时候就容易出错,想象一下,你要数一堆苹果的数量,结果里面混了几个玩具,那你能数对吗?肯定不行呀!🍎

(二)数值范围超出限制📏

Origin 软件对能处理的数值大小是有范围的,如果你要计算的阶乘数值太大,超出了这个范围,那就会报错啦,这就好比一个小口袋,你硬要塞进去一个大西瓜,肯定是塞不进去的嘛,你要计算 100 的阶乘,可能对于 Origin 来说就有点“压力山大”了,因为它处理不了这么大数值的阶乘运算。🍉

(三)函数使用不当😅

在使用 Origin 的函数来进行阶乘运算时,如果函数的参数设置错误或者函数本身就不适合当前的运算场景,也会引发报错,就好像你拿错了工具去干活,那肯定干不好呀,比如说,你应该用专门的阶乘函数,结果却用了其他不相关的函数,这怎么能不出问题呢?🔧

为何Origin环境中阶乘计算出现错误?-图2
(图片来源网络,侵权删除)

三、怎么解决阶乘报错呢?🤗

(一)检查数据格式🧐

咱得先把数据好好检查一遍,看看里面有没有奇怪的东西,如果有非数字的字符,就赶紧删掉或者转换成数字格式,可以用 Origin 自带的数据清洗功能,就像是给数据来个“大扫除”,把那些没用的“垃圾”都清理掉,这样数据干净了,运算的时候就不会因为格式问题而报错啦。🧹

(二)合理选择数值范围📊

在开始计算阶乘之前,要先大概估算一下数值的大小,确保它在 Origin 能处理的范围内,如果数值太大了,可以考虑一些其他的方法来近似计算或者分步计算,比如说,你可以把一个大数值分成几个小部分,分别计算它们的阶乘,然后再组合起来得到结果,这就好比你搬不动一个大石头,那就把它分成几块小石头,一块一块搬就轻松多了。🪨

(三)正确使用函数📋

仔细阅读 Origin 的帮助文档,了解每个函数的功能和用法,在使用时,要确保函数的参数设置正确,并且选择适合当前运算场景的函数,如果不确定,可以多试试不同的函数,看看哪个能用,这就像是找钥匙开锁,总能找到一把合适的钥匙打开那扇门。🗝️

四、案例分析:从报错到成功📈

咱来看个实际的例子哈,有个小伙伴在做物理实验数据处理的时候,需要计算一组数据的阶乘来分析实验结果的误差范围,一开始,他把数据直接复制到 Origin 里,也没管格式啥的,结果一运行就报错了。😫

为何Origin环境中阶乘计算出现错误?-图3
(图片来源网络,侵权删除)

后来,他按照咱们上面说的方法,先检查了数据格式,发现里面有几个字母,原来是记录数据的时候不小心输错了,他把字母删掉后,又重新运行了一下,还是报错,这次他仔细一看,发现要计算的数值有点大,超出了 Origin 的处理范围,他把数据分成了几组,分别计算每组的阶乘,再把它们加起来,最后终于得到了正确的结果。😃

通过这个例子可以看出来,遇到阶乘报错别慌张,只要一步一步排查问题,总能找到解决的办法。💪

其实啊,在学习和使用 Origin 的过程中,遇到报错是很正常的事情,就像小孩子学走路难免会摔倒一样,关键是要保持乐观的心态,把这些报错当成是学习的机会,每次解决了一个问题,咱就又进步了一点。😉我相信,只要你按照这些方法去做,以后再遇到 Origin 阶乘报错,肯定能轻松应对啦!加油哦,新手小白们!🌟

本站部分图片及内容来源网络,版权归原作者所有,转载目的为传递知识,不代表本站立场。若侵权或违规联系Email:zjx77377423@163.com 核实后第一时间删除。 转载请注明出处:https://blog.huochengrm.cn/gz/27166.html

分享:
扫描分享到社交APP
上一篇
下一篇